It follows up on some questions that were asked last week by Mr. Braden about the Northwest Territories Family Counselling Services. Mr. Speaker, the Northwest Territories Family Counselling Services provides many important services and programs for the community, such as family life education and community support for family advocacy.
The cuts they will take now as a result of the change in this governments' contracting on the Employee and Family Assistance Program will effect programs at the YWCA, the Women's Centre, the Aboriginal Community Healing Circle, and individuals in Yellowknife. Mr. Speaker, with the recent awarding of the contract for the GNWT Employee and Family Assistance Program to a new consortium that is twice the cost of the proposal the Northwest Territories Family Counselling Services had offered, they have now lost a good portion of their funding. They will be about $140,000 short for the coming fiscal year.
I would like to ask the Premier if he will commit to finding funding that would allow Northwest Territories Family Counselling Services to continue to offer these crucial programs to the community? Thank you, Mr. Speaker.
